Who They Are
iCredit One Auto Finance focuses on helping people with various credit situations get financing for a vehicle. They work with a network of dealerships to offer loan options. Unlike some lenders that cater exclusively to those with stellar credit, iCredit One often works with individuals who might have less-than-perfect credit histories. This can be a lifeline for many who need a car but struggle to get approved elsewhere.
What They Offer
The primary service, of course, is auto loans. These loans are designed to help you purchase a new or used vehicle. iCredit One Auto Finance typically offers a range of loan terms and amounts, depending on your individual circumstances and the vehicle you're interested in. They also provide options for refinancing existing auto loans, which could potentially lower your monthly payments or interest rate. It's always a good idea to explore all available options to find the one that best fits your financial situation.
How They Work
The process usually starts with an application through a participating dealership. The dealership then works with iCredit One to get you approved. Keep in mind that interest rates and terms can vary widely based on your credit score, the age and type of vehicle, and the loan amount. It’s crucial to carefully review the terms of the loan agreement before signing anything. Pay attention to the interest rate, the monthly payment amount, the total cost of the loan (including interest), and any potential fees.
What to Watch Out For
Like with any financial product, it's essential to do your homework. Auto loans for individuals with lower credit scores often come with higher interest rates. Make sure you understand the total cost of the loan and that you can comfortably afford the monthly payments. It’s also wise to shop around and compare offers from multiple lenders to ensure you're getting the best possible deal. Look beyond just the monthly payment; consider the long-term financial implications.

Common Questions About iCredit One Auto Finance
Let’s tackle some of the common questions people often have about iCredit One Auto Finance. Getting clear on these FAQs can help you feel more confident and informed.
What Credit Score Do I Need to Get Approved?
One of the most frequent questions is about the minimum credit score required for approval. iCredit One Auto Finance often works with individuals who have less-than-perfect credit, so there isn't a strict minimum score. However, your credit score will play a significant role in determining the interest rate and loan terms you receive. Generally, the higher your credit score, the better the terms you'll qualify for. Even if you have a lower score, it's still worth applying, but be prepared for potentially higher interest rates.
Can I Refinance My Existing Auto Loan with iCredit One?
Yes, iCredit One Auto Finance does offer options for refinancing existing auto loans. Refinancing can be a smart move if you're looking to lower your monthly payments, reduce your interest rate, or change the terms of your loan. To determine if refinancing is right for you, compare the terms of your current loan with the terms iCredit One can offer. Consider factors such as interest rates, fees, and the total cost of the loan over its lifetime.
What Are the Interest Rates Like?
Interest rates can vary widely depending on several factors, including your credit score, the type of vehicle you're financing, and the loan term. Because iCredit One often works with individuals with less-than-perfect credit, the interest rates may be higher than what you'd find with lenders who cater exclusively to those with excellent credit. It's essential to shop around and compare rates from multiple lenders to ensure you're getting the best possible deal. Always look at the annual percentage rate (APR), which includes the interest rate and any fees, to get a clear picture of the total cost of the loan.
What Fees Can I Expect?
Like with any auto loan, there may be fees associated with iCredit One Auto Finance. These can include origination fees, application fees, late payment fees, and prepayment penalties. Make sure you carefully review the loan agreement to understand all the potential fees. Don't hesitate to ask the lender to explain any fees you're unsure about. Knowing what fees to expect can help you budget accordingly and avoid surprises.
How Do I Make Payments?
iCredit One Auto Finance typically offers several options for making payments. These can include online payments, phone payments, mail-in payments, and automatic payments. Setting up automatic payments is a convenient way to ensure you never miss a payment. Be sure to check with iCredit One for the specific payment methods they accept and any associated fees. Always make payments on time to avoid late fees and protect your credit score.
